A Step-By-Step Process to Pick the Best School for Your Kid in Noida

‍Many parents struggle while selecting the best school in Noida for their child. The experience can be quite daunting with so many institutions offering diverse surroundings, teaching styles, and ideologies.

Whether you’re enrolling in a public or private school, thorough planning is essential. As you go through the process of selecting a school for your child, examine the following questions and put down your ideas on paper.

Remember, you’re searching for a school that will make your child’s educational experience as rewarding as possible. Here is a list of steps to follow while selecting the best school in Noida for your children.

Step 1: Consider Your Child’s Needs and School Fees While Selecting the Best School in Noida

Consider what you want a school to do for your child as you begin your search for the finest school. Perhaps your child has particular needs in terms of language or education. Remember to keep them in mind. After all, you are the one who knows your child better than anybody else.

This also flows into which board to choose from, whether it should be ICSE, CBSE, SSC, IG, or Cambridge. Please be aware that this is one of the most critical steps. It’s also natural to be perplexed when there’s so much information available online.

To make a decision, have a thorough discussion with your partner on each board. Additionally, consider the Noida school fees. We want to push ourselves as parents to give the best for our children.

However, when settling on a budget, be practical and reasonable. It’s never just about the Noida school fees; there are a slew of other expenses to consider, such as transportation, equipment for extracurricular activities, picnics, and annual festivities, to name a few core costs.‍

Step 2: Gather Information About the School

If you wanted to buy a car, vacuum cleaner, or refrigerator, you could chat to friends and family and research online, in consumer magazines, or in other printed resources.

Similarly, when looking into schools, you may need to make phone calls, collect written materials from various schools, and seek for reports in your local newspaper and read reviews by searching in Google in order to obtain the information you require.

You can also read reviews from the school’s website, friends, and family members, among other places. Talk to some of the students who attend these institutions if possible, as different people have varied expectations and perceptions of excellence.

Speaking with students from the school will help you determine if it meets your expectations and quality perceptions. Take into consideration factors like distance, If you do have decent schools within walking distance, you must decide what is most important.

It entails determining how much time you and your child will have to devote to a distant school and whether or not that school is worthwhile.

Step 3: Check if the School Uses  Effective Teaching Methods

The most important information to gather is to know what teaching methods are used in the school and if they’re suitable for your child. Teaching styles can either promote or inhibit learning.

Students that are engaged with the subject matter and enjoy studying might benefit from an effective teaching style.

Teachers are gradually revising their techniques in accordance with evidence-based practices and their students’ learning needs as their teaching styles evolve as a result of a better understanding of how kids learn.

Different teaching styles can be used by the most effective teachers based on what they are teaching and what their students’ goals are.

Step 4: Visit and Observe Schools

Make an appointment to visit the schools you’re interested in by contacting them. If feasible, visit a few classes and tour the schools during regular school hours. To gain a fair idea of how a school runs, avoid visiting during the first or last week of the term.

Scheduling an appointment with the school principal is a wonderful method to get answers to your questions. Attend an open house, parent-teacher meeting, or other school activity if possible, as this will give you useful information about staff, students, and parents’ perspectives.

Once there, examine the playground, sports area, laboratories, cafeteria, benches, boards, projectors, and other amenities which will be a part of the Noida school fees. Do not be afraid to inspect the school’s washrooms, as this is where you will learn about the school’s hygiene standards.

Make sure to bring your child along on the tour of the school facilities and ask them if they want to be a part of that school. Children, regardless of their age, have views and are extremely sensitive to the energies around them.

If you see your child is uncomfortable about any aspect of school, pay attention to it and respect his or her feelings.

Also have a list of questions on your phone before you go to the appointment so you don’t forget to ask anything. Obtain the admittance form prior to your visit so that you can clarify any questions you may have about the information included therein.

Step 5: Apply to the Schools You Choose

You will go through the process of applying to the best school in Noida (or schools) of your choice and enrolling your child once you have chosen the school(s) that you believe will be the greatest fit for your child.

If your child is not accepted to their first choice, consider applying to multiple schools. You should start this process as soon as possible to guarantee that you meet all of the dates. Admissions procedures differ from one institution to the next.

You may be asked to give a school transcript, recommendations, or other documents in order for your child to be tested or interviewed. It would be beneficial to understand the school’s admissions standards.
